Pineapple Financial Inc. (NYSEAMERICAN:PAPL) Sees Large Increase in Short Interest

Pineapple Financial Inc. (NYSEAMERICAN:PAPLGet Free Report) was the recipient of a large growth in short interest in the month of July. As of July 15th, there was short interest totalling 28,200 shares, a growth of 156.4% from the June 30th total of 11,000 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 265,400 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.1 days. Approximately 0.8% of the shares of the stock are sold short.

Pineapple Financial Inc operates as a mortgage technology and brokerage company in Canada. The company provides mortgage brokerage services and technology solutions to Canadian mortgage agents, brokers, sub-brokers, brokerages, and consumers; and mortgage consultation services through field agents. It also operates MyPineapple, a technology platform that allows users to conduct their brokerage services.
